在 VS Code 中运行 Python 代码的快捷键和常用方法如下:
一、基础运行方式
1. 使用 VS Code 内置运行按钮
-
快捷键:
-
Windows/Linux:
Ctrl + F5
(直接运行,不调试)或F5
(启动调试) -
macOS:
Cmd + F5
(直接运行)或F5
(调试)
-
-
操作步骤:
-
确保文件已保存(
.py
后缀)。 -
点击右上角的 ▶️ 运行按钮 或按快捷键。
-
首次运行时会提示选择调试配置,选择 Python File 即可。
-
2. 在终端中运行
-
快捷键:
-
Windows/Linux:`Ctrl + Shift + ``(打开终端)
-
macOS:`Cmd + Shift + ``
-
-
手动输入命令:
python your_file.py
二、高效运行方式
1. 使用 Code Runner 扩展
-
安装扩展:在 VS Code 扩展商店搜索 Code Runner 并安装。
-
快捷键:
-
Windows/Linux:
Ctrl + Alt + N
-
macOS:
Ctrl + Option + N
-
-
特点:
-
直接输出结果在 VS Code 的输出面板。
-
支持快速运行单文件。
-
2. 右键菜单运行
-
在代码编辑区右键选择 Run Python File in Terminal,效果等同于终端输入
python your_file.py
。
三、调试运行
1. 调试模式
-
快捷键:
-
通用:
F5
(启动调试)
-
-
操作步骤:
-
设置断点:在行号左侧单击添加断点。
-
按
F5
启动调试。 -
使用调试工具栏控制流程(继续、单步执行等)。
-
2. 调试快捷键
-
继续执行:
F5
-
单步跳过(Step Over):
F10
-
单步进入(Step Into):
F11
-
重启调试:
Ctrl + Shift + F5
(Windows) /Cmd + Shift + F5
(macOS)
四、自定义运行配置
若需复杂运行参数(如命令行参数):
-
创建
launch.json
:-
按
Ctrl + Shift + D
打开运行侧边栏。 -
点击 create a launch.json file,选择 Python File。
-
-
修改配置示例:
{ "name": "Python: 当前文件", "type": "python", "request": "launch", "program": "${file}", "args": ["--arg1", "value1"], // 添加命令行参数 "console": "integratedTerminal" }
五、常见问题解决
-
快捷键无效:
-
检查是否安装 Python 扩展(Microsoft 官方出品)。
-
确保文件路径不含中文或特殊字符。
-
-
Code Runner 未输出结果:
-
在 VS Code 设置中搜索 Code-runner: Run In Terminal,勾选此项(确保代码在终端运行)。
-
-
权限问题:
-
若提示权限错误,尝试以管理员身份运行 VS Code。
-
六、操作示例
-
快速运行:
-
按
Ctrl + Alt + N
(Code Runner)→ 输出面板显示结果。
-
-
调试:
-
设置断点 → 按
F5
→ 观察变量变化。
-
通过灵活使用这些方法,你可以快速运行和调试 Python 代码!